Natural Substrates | Organism | Comment (Nat. Sub.) | Natural Products | Comment (Nat. Pro.) | Rev. | Reac. |
---|---|---|---|---|---|---|
S-adenosyl-L-methionine + isoliquiritigenin | Medicago sativa | the product of the reaction, 2'-O-methylisoliquiritigenin, is the most potent inducer of nodulation genes of Rhizobium meliloti, the symbiont of Medicago sativa which forms nitrogen-fixing nodules | S-adenosyl-L-homocysteine + 2'-O-methylisoliquiritigenin | - |
